Digital lock detect
window
If the time difference of the rising edges at the inputs to the PFD is less than the lock detect window time, the digital
lock detect flag is set. The flag remains set until the time difference is greater than the loss-of-lock threshold.
0: high range (default).
1: low range.

[2:1] VCO cal divider VCO calibration divider. Divider used to generate the VCO calibration clock from the PLL reference clock.
2 1 VCO Calibration Clock Divider
0 0 2. This setting is fine for PFD frequencies < 12.5 MHz. The PFD frequency is f
REF
/R.
0 1 4. This setting is fine for PFD frequencies < 25 MHz.
1 0 8. This setting is fine for PFD frequencies < 50 MHz.
1 1 16 (default). This setting is fine for any PFD frequency but also results in the longest VCO calibration time.
0 VCO cal now
Bit used to initiate VCO calibration. This bit must be toggled from 0b to 1b in the active registers. To initiate calibration,
use the following three steps: first, ensure that the input reference signal is present; second, set to 0b (if not zero
already), followed by the update all registers bit (Register 0x232, Bit 0); and third, program to 1b, again followed by the
update all registers bit (Register 0x232, Bit 0). Clearing this bit discards the VCO calibration and usually results in the
PLL losing lock. The user must ensure that the holdover enable bits in Register 0x01D = 00b during VCO calibration.
